Andreams Homes CEO Andrew Adama Appointed IAWPA Eminent Peace Ambassador
By Genesis Ogiri
ABUJA — Engr. Andrew Adama, Chief Executive Officer of Andreams Homes and Properties Limited, has been appointed an Eminent Peace Ambassador by the International Association of World Peace Advocates (IAWPA), in recognition of his leadership in the real estate sector, entrepreneurial contributions and growing connections with peacebuilding, social cohesion and societal development.
The prestigious appointment was announced in Abuja during the National Stakeholders’ Security Dialogue organised to commemorate the United Nations International Day of Police Cooperation, bringing together stakeholders from government, security agencies, civil society organisations and other critical sectors of society.
The dialogue, held under the theme, “Policing for Peace: Building Synergy for a Safer Nigeria,” provided a strategic platform for stakeholders to deliberate on stronger institutional collaboration, community engagement, dialogue and collective action towards addressing security challenges and promoting a safer Nigeria.
IAWPA said its Eminent Peace Ambassador Award is reserved for individuals whose work demonstrates measurable societal impact, independent leadership and alignment with global peace and development priorities, including the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
The Association stressed that the honour is strictly merit-based and is not conferred on the basis of affiliation or ceremonial participation, but on the substance, scale and sustainability of documented contributions to society.
